Ariana Grande has launched the Brighter Days Ahead Foundation.
Its mission is to support and provide resources for vulnerable people, with a particular focus on protecting trans and LGBTQ+ rights.

Singer Becky Hill has hit back at Jack Whitehall on her new album Rebecca after he branded her “Wetherspoons Whitney” while hosting the 2025 BRIT Awards.
The track calls out classism with lyrics aimed squarely at the privately educated comedian: “Just ’cause your daddy worked in showbiz, got you a job with his old boss… You judge me on my accent before I even start.”
At an intimate gig this week, Hill introduced the song live, saying: “This one’s for you, Jack,” and jokingly renamed it “Daddy’s Range Rover.”
Whitehall, 37, who attended £60k-a-year Marlborough College and is the son of top talent agent Michael Whitehall, has hosted the BRITs six times.
Becky Hill’s album response has gone viral among fans accusing the comedian of “punching down” on working-class artists.
